Every year thousands of people take on challenge events to raise money for our hospice. We want your energy, your ideas and your ambition to grow our programme of challenge events, help us take the next step and create new unmissable challenges in Leicester.

And it’s not just local, this exciting role offers the chance to plan and organise international events, with recent overseas challenges taking LOROS as far as Peru or the Sahara! You’ll feel a real affinity with our event supporters and understand what makes them tick, creating events which motivate them to sign up and get them fundraising for an amazing cause.

Responsibilities & Requirements

An exciting opportunity has arisen for an enthusiastic individual to become part of the ambitious Events Team at LOROS. As Challenge Events Fundraising Coordinator, you encourage participation in predominantly third-party challenge events, such as The London Marathon, Skydives, International Treks, The Run Leicester Festival and other exciting UK-based challenges.

Managing our portfolio of challenge events, you will have experience of fundraising as part of a charity challenge, either professionally or in your own time, and will empathise with supporters such that you can support them on their challenge journey to help them reach their fundraising goals. You will work closely with external stakeholders to facilitate challenge events, ensuring they meet our own high standards for events.

To be successful, you will have excellent organisational skills, a great eye for detail, initiative, and be an excellent communicator, both written and oral. You will be confident in speaking and presenting to groups and must be able to manage multiple deadlines simultaneously.

The ideal applicant will be passionate, persuasive and be able to motivate people to take up a challenge they may never have considered before. The successful applicant with have a great work ethic and be willing and able to work long hours over weekend and evenings during busy event periods.
